Rehabilitation therapy for patients with glioma: A PRISMA-compliant systematic review and meta-analysis
BACKGROUND: Glioma is the most common type of brain tumor because of the destructiveness of the disease itself and the side effects of treatment, patients often leave symptoms of neurological defects.
